Calculation of Magnetic Stiffness over Torque between Two
Current-Carrying Circular Filaments Arbitrarily Positioning in the Space

Abstract
The sets of expressions for calculation of sixteen components of
magnetic stiffness over torque between two current-carrying circular
filaments arbitrarily positioning in the space are derived by using
mutual inductance and Grover's method. The expressions are presented in
the analytical form via integral equations, whose kernels include the
elliptic functions of first and second kinds. The derived sets of
formulas were mutually validated and results of calculation of
components of magnetic stiffness agree well to each other.
